Output 26e06cfcde77b9c3f116801af693c38c8a3b0e1927f430dcf9fa98e51c4257ad:7

value
23689810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da425ba60e96c9827539cf3618b7be6bdd0af1e8 OP_EQUAL
address
MToD2tEG2rSK2YnZMqHwufgL6yWrQMgwNK
transaction
26e06cfcde77b9c3f116801af693c38c8a3b0e1927f430dcf9fa98e51c4257ad
spent
true